For about a decade, the human microbiota has been investigated using molecular procedures that are now systematized via metagenomics. Several large scale studies are underway with the goal of establishing a set of reference data, such as catalogues of genes, microbial species and complete genome sequences of strains colonizing the various body sites. A first series of conclusions can be drawn from this 'natural history' approach that will also lay the ground for further studies aiming at understanding--in an ecological perspective--the mechanisms ensuring stable operation of the microbiota in healthy individuals, and how changes in its composition (dysbiosis) may result in diseases.
